Closed paths of light trapped in a closed Fermat curve
Authors:Thierry Dana-Picard  Aaron Naiman
Institution:Department of Computer Science and Applied Mathematics , Aston University , Aston Triangle, Birmingham B4 7ET, England
Abstract:Geometric constructions have previously been shown that can be interpreted as rays of light trapped either in polygons or in conics, by successive reflections. The same question, trapping light in closed Fermat curves, is addressed here. Numerical methods are used to study the behaviour of the reflection points of a triangle when the degree of the curve varies, including a generalization to non integer powers.
